Night-shift access for the support team at Tollgate House follows a separate procedure from daytime visitors. Between 22:00 and 06:00, the main doors at Perrin Way are locked and the side lobby becomes the only entry point. Reception staff on the late rota should confirm each support team member against the printed roster before releasing the inner door. Personal guests are not permitted during these hours under any circumstances. Support staff arriving without their own badge may be admitted using the shared night code below.

staff pass of yagep-tajep = bdg-TRT-1

Deep-link routing on Fernwick Mobile: if links open the home screen instead of the target view, check the route manifest bundled at build time, not the server config. Stale manifests come from cached build agents. Purge the agent cache and rebuild. The last known-good build is referenced below.

trace token, bagag-fahag: htk21_1a5003b533f7b0cca4331

Runbook: encoding detection for uploaded text files. The Glyphbarrow ingest service sniffs uploads using a BOM check first, then a statistical pass over the first 64 KB. Files it cannot classify with confidence are routed to the quarantine queue, not rejected — check that queue before telling a customer their file is corrupt. Misdetections usually mean the confidence threshold was tuned down during an incident and never restored. The detector currently runs with the following configuration values.

service settings:
novath:
  pin: 1396
  tenant: pelys
  seal: seal_ccc035e1
  metrics_host: metrics.novath.qorvelworks.test
  standby_team: fraeth
  escalation: drueth-zorok
  nonce: 61d508

# Front Desk — Visitor Handling

All visitors to the Corvander Building check in at the ground-floor desk. Confirm the host's name, issue a dated visitor sticker, and ask visitors to wait in the lobby until collected. Hosts must escort their guests at all times; unaccompanied visitors should be walked back to the desk. At checkout, collect stickers and log the departure time. Deliveries are redirected to the mailroom. If a host is unreachable, a desk staffer may escort the visitor to the second-floor meeting pod using the door code below.

door code, yagap-bahof: bdg-O-05